There are a few generally accepted definitions of manga, from its literal translation of “whimsical or impromptu pictures” to the more common “Japanese comics.” There’s also the looser description many non-manga fans use, as Benn Ray, co-owner of Atomic Books, recently noted: “Most of the people looking for manga erroneously refer to it ‘the anime.'” Now more than ever, understanding this key category is critical.” Readers have been diving into manga as a big form of COVID era entertainment, and there’s growth across the board, even in the channels most affected by COVID shutdowns. “Manga had a spectacular year in 2020 despite the global COVID pandemic.
